I agree there is a huge difference between being legally insane and not responsible for one’s actions and being delusional but culpable. And I agree that she has delusions…now…and I think she brought those delusions upon herself.I do not believe anyone on this thread has suggested Lori is insane.
Delusional is not the same thing as insane.
I am in the camp of her truly believing her delusions, but it is a spectrum. She believes and never was aware her brain made it up? she made it up and now believes her own lies? She made it up and really wants to believe herself? She made it up and knows they are lies?
It doesn't really matter which it is.
What matters is if she was able to determine right from wrong. She knows murder is wrong. She either "knows" or pretends to know that Jesus was cool with the murders. She "knows" or pretends to know that Tylee, JJ, and Tammy are happily busy.
But she obviously knows for real that murder is illegal. Otherwise, why would she blather about accidents and suicides. She knows to tell the police that JJ is with a friend in AZ rather than buried nearby. Lori took a number of actions to disguise the actions she knew were illegal.
Therefore, she is aware of her actions, and the consequences of getting caught for them. This makes her both sane and responsible for her actions.
Whether she also has delusions of speaking spirits or not does not change her consciousness of guilt.
